M-KOPA Android Engineer Jobs in Ghana

M-KOPA Android Engineer Jobs in Ghana



We are looking for an Android Engineer with Mid to Senior level experience to join our repayments group that sits within the engineering team. The group is made up of 3 agile teams which are focused on Payment flows, Core lending and Loan repayment experience and IoT device control.

Collaboration

As an engineer, you will work with a cross-functional team of android, backend engineers, product managers and testers to design, develop, and maintain M-KOPA’s Customer apps, and deliver software that scales with both company and customer growth.

Additionally, you would be working on a variety of aspects that include deep diving user journeys using data and implementing focused updates to address our customer’s needs; and collaborating with fellow Android engineers to improve application quality and raise coding standards.

Tech Stack

Our teams work in a self-organized agile fashion where they keep track of their work in Azure DevOps, which we also use for our CI/CD, Kotlin for our Android apps and .NET for our backend. Our cloud provider is Azure, where our microservices are hosted in Azure Kubernetes Services, and we implement Android applications following clean architecture principles, unidirectional data flow and jetpack compose.

Flexibility

Our roles are fully remote, within the following time zone (UTC -1 / UTC+3). Our engineers
work remotely from locations such as UK, Europe and Africa.

If you like taking a product-focused approach to development and driving changes using data to guide your decisions, taking ownership, coupled with a commercial experience in Android and Kotlin then this might just be the job for you.

Expertise

Our expectation is that you have a background working for a large-scale product and you are familiar with Trunk-based development, Clean Architecture, Dependency Injection, Uni-directional data flow (MVI), Feature Toggles, Docker and Azure DevOps. Additionally, understanding the importance of testing and experience in writing clear and reliable tests as well as being aware of testing best practices is very key for the role.

We are looking for strong experience with Kotlin, Android app development, clean

How to Apply

For more information and job application details, see; M-KOPA Android Engineer Jobs in Ghana

Find daily jobs in Ghana. Jobs - Ghana jobs. Search our career portal & find the latest Ghana job positions, career opportunities & jobs in Ghana.

Jobs in Ghana - banking jobs, IT jobs, accounting jobs, NGO jobs, business administration, ICT, UN jobs, procurement jobs, education jobs, hospital jobs, human resources jobs, engineering, teaching jobs, and other careers in Ghana.

Find your dream job from 1000s of vacancies in Ghana posted and updated daily - click here!

Click here to post comments

Join in and write your own page! It's easy to do. How? Simply click here to return to 3 Best Africa Jobs.